Maui wildfire report: Officials declined extra help before a deadly inferno engulfed Lahaina, killing more than 100 people - Boston News, Weather, Sports

Summary by WHDH
(CNN) — A new report on the disastrous Maui infernos that left 101 people dead and $6 billion in damages reveals officials rejected additional help before the Lahaina fire obliterated hundreds of homes and became the deadliest US wildfire in more than a century.
